My invention relates to casings for meters and other apparatus and concerns particularly casing arrangements for preventing unauthorized persons from interfering with the operation of apparatus to be protected.
It is an object of my invention to provide a simplified, inexpensive easily manufactured arrangement for sealing meters, instruments, and other apparatus.
It is another object of my invention to provide an arrangement for sealing an electrical device independently of its terminal chamber.
It is still another object of my invention to provide an arrangement whereby a single seal serves to seal both the terminal chamber and the electrical device itself.
' Other and further objects of my invention will become apparent as the description proceeds.
Although my invention is not limited to use with electrical meters it is particularly well adapted to such use and will be described in connection with electrical meters. In accordance with my invention in its preferred form, a casing is utilized having a base portion with separate chambers, one for mounting the meter itself and another for the terminals. A cover is provided for each chamber. The meter cover, which is preferably circular in section, is attached tothe base by means of a bayonet look so that the meter cover may be attached and removed by twisting movement. The terminal chamber is provided with a cover which may be attached to the base at one end by sliding movement. Both the meter cover and the terminal cover are provided with means which engage a sliding member which serves to lock the meter cover and the terminal cover when the sliding member is in its locking position.
The sliding member is provided with an arm having a slot which cooperates with a lug in the base of the casing to permit locking the meter cover in position independently of the terminal cover. The sliding member is also provided with a transversely extending lug which cooperates with a slot in the otherwise unsecured end of the terminal cover so that a seal may be inserted in this lug to prevent the removal of the terminal cover or the retraction of the sliding member so that both covers may be locked by a single seal.

Referring now more in detail to the drawing in which like parts are designated by like reference characters throughout, the meter casing illustrated in the drawing comprises a base porto tion 11 having a chamber in the upper portion 12 thereof to receive an electrical meter mechanism or other similar device' and a terminal chamber 13 in the lower portion thereof to receive terminals for making connection between the 5 circuits of the meter mechanism and the permanent wiring of an electrical system (not shown). The meter chamber is closed by means of a meter cover 14 which may, if desired, be composed of a transparent cup-shaped portion 15 and a collar ldunited thereto. Means are provided for removably attaching the cover 14 to the base 11. The meter cover 14 which is preferably circular is provided with hook-shaped members 17 cooperating with suitably shaped slots 18 in the base 11 to permit securing the cover 14 to the base 11 by rotary or twisting motion in a given direction. The connection is similar to a bayonet lock and permits the cover 14 to be removed from the base 11 only by rotating the cover 14 in the on reverse direction. Although only one hookshaped member 17 and cooperating slot 18 are visible in the drawing it will be understood that preferably a plurality of such connecting means are provided around the periphery of the cover 14. Preferably the collar 16 overhangs the circular portion 12 of the base 11 to form a closely fitting flange which prevents the insertion of tools into the meter chamber to interfere with the meter operation.
The cover 14 is provided with a projection 19, which may if desired be formed in the collar 16, to cooperate with the nose 20 of a sliding locking. member 21. The sliding member 21 is slidably m5 supported on the base 11 by means of a pair of rivets 22 cooperating with a slot 23 in the sliding member 21. The position of the rivets 22 and the length of slot 23 are such that the sliding member 21 may be moved between an unlocked 11 position as in Figures 2 and. 4 and a locking position as in Figures 1 and 3.
The sliding member 21 is bent at the end away from nose 20 to form a transverse arm 24 having a slot 25 cooperating with a lug 26 attached to the base 11 in such a manner that when the sliding member 21 is moved to the locking position, the lug 26 projects through the slot 25 in the sliding member 21 permitting the insertion of a sealing wire 27, the ends of which may be joined by suitable device such as a lead seal 28. Obviously the .presence of the nose 20 and the projection 19 prevents rotation of the cover 14 in the unlocking direction and removal of the cover when the sliding member 21 is in its locking position. It will be understood, however, that my invention is not limited to this precise arrangement for causing engagement of a locking member and a meter cover. With the sliding member 21 in the locking position and the sealing wire 27 in place, the meter mechanism may be sealed independently of the meter terminals, as illustrated in Fig. 1, to prevent tampering with the meter mechanism after it has been adjusted without interfering with the installation and connection or test of the meter by a meter installer who is thus permitted to'have access to the terminals 29 in the terminal chamber 13.
The terminal chamber 13 is provided with a cover 30 of a type already known having a slot 31 adjacent an upset portion 31 cooperating with a headed stud 32 attached to base 11 near the end of the terminal chamber 13. The left hand end of the terminal cover 30 may be secured to base 11 in a manner familiar to those skilled in the art by dropping the upset portion 31' over the head of the stud 32 and sliding the terminal cover 30 to the right, bringing the sides of the slot 31 under the head of the stud 32. The other end of the terminal cover 30 is provided with a slot 33 cooperating with a lug 34 extending transversely from the arm 24 of the sliding member 21. The parts are so dimensioned that the terminal cover 30 can be dropped in position with the lug 34 projecting through the slot 33 only when the sliding member 21 is moved to the left to its locking position and the terminal cover 30 is in its extreme right hand position with the slot 31 locked under the head of the stud 32. A sealing wire 35 may then be inserted in the lug 34 or if desired through both lugs 34 and 26. However, even if the seal 35 is inserted in lug 34 only, the removal of the terminal cover 30 is prevented and likewise the retraction of the sliding member 21 is also prevented, so that the meter cover 14 cannot be rotated in the unlocking direction and both the meter mechanism and the terminal chamber are locked by the single seal 35 in the Inc 34.
